    How to Get From Phnom Penh to Siem Reap
    The Phnom Penh to Siem Reap route is Cambodia's most traveled corridor, connecting the capital city to Angkor Wat. At 315 km, you have multiple transport options ranging from $10 buses to $100+ flights. Here's everything you need to know.

    Our Recommendation

    For most travelers, the bus is the best balance of cost and comfort. If time is limited, fly — it's only 45 minutes. Private transfers are ideal for groups of 3+ who want door-to-door convenience.

    🚀 All Transport Options

    ✈️ Domestic Flight

    Recommended
    premium

    Duration

    45 minutes

    Cost

    $60–$120

    Frequency

    Multiple daily flights

    Cambodia Angkor Air and several budget carriers operate this route. The new Siem Reap-Angkor International Airport (SAI) opened in 2023. Factor in airport transfer time (40 min from city to SAI).

    Insider Tips

    • •Book 2–4 weeks ahead for best prices
    • •New SAI airport is 40 km from Siem Reap center
    • •Airport taxi to city costs $12–15
    • •Morning flights avoid afternoon storm delays

    🚌 Express Bus

    Recommended
    comfortable

    Duration

    5.5–6.5 hours

    Cost

    $10–$18

    Frequency

    Departures every 30–60 min (6am–1pm)

    Giant Ibis, Mekong Express, and Capitol Bus are the top operators. Giant Ibis is the gold standard with wifi, USB charging, snacks, and reliable schedules. Road quality is good (NR6) with one rest stop.

    Insider Tips

    • •Book Giant Ibis online at giantibis.com
    • •Sit on the left side for better views
    • •Bring a light jacket — AC is strong
    • •NR6 road is fully paved and smooth

    🚐 Private Transfer / Taxi

    comfortable

    Duration

    5–6 hours

    Cost

    $70–$120

    Frequency

    On demand

    Private cars (sedan or SUV) offer door-to-door service. Price is per vehicle, making it excellent value for 3–4 people. Book through your hotel or apps like PassApp and Grab.

    Insider Tips

    • •Negotiate price before departure
    • •Ask for a stop at Skun (spider market) or Kompong Cham
    • •Price is per vehicle — split with travel mates
    • •PassApp offers fixed prices

    🚤 Speedboat (Seasonal)

    basic

    Duration

    5–6 hours

    Cost

    $35–$40

    Frequency

    Daily (wet season: July–March)

    Scenic route via Tonlé Sap lake. Only operates when water levels are high enough. Uncomfortable seats but incredible views of floating villages. Not recommended for those prone to seasickness.

    Insider Tips

    • •Only available roughly July to March
    • •Bring sunscreen and a hat
    • •Sit near the middle for less bouncing
    • •Not suitable for young children or elderly

    ❓ Frequently Asked Questions

    What is the fastest way from Phnom Penh to Siem Reap?

    Flying takes only 45 minutes. Several airlines operate multiple daily flights starting from $60 one way.

    What is the cheapest way to get from Phnom Penh to Siem Reap?

    The bus costs $10–18. Giant Ibis and Mekong Express are the most popular operators with comfortable coaches.

    Is the road from Phnom Penh to Siem Reap safe?

    Yes, National Route 6 is fully paved and in good condition. Stick to reputable bus companies for the safest experience.

    Can I stop at Angkor Wat on the way?

    Angkor Wat is in Siem Reap, which is the destination. You'll arrive ready to explore the next day.
